README
XMP Toolkit *********** Exiv2 uses the XMPCore component of the Adobe XMP Toolkit (XMP SDK) to parse and serialize XMP packets. Temporarily, it is integrated and distributed together with Exiv2. The xmpsdk/ directory of the Exiv2 distribution (this directory) contains the XMP SDK source code. The final solution will rely on an external XMP Toolkit, once it is available as a standalone package from Linux distros. Building the XMP Toolkit is transparent. Following the installation steps described in the top-level Exiv2 README file will ensure that the XMP Toolkit is compiled if necessary. It is only needed if XMP support is enabled. Building the XMP Toolkit results in a static library xmpsdk/lib/libxmpsdk.a. This library is not installed on the system and is not meant to be used as a standalone library. It is only used to build Exiv2. If you experience problems building this library, please email to the Exiv2 support forum for help, see http://www.exiv2.org/support.html and not to Adobe directly. Source ====== XMP Toolkit 4.1.1 (xmp_v411_sdk.zip) from http://www.adobe.com/devnet/xmp/sdk/eula.html The following files were copied from the original XMP SDK distribution: public/include/* -> include source/common/* -> src source/XMPCore/* -> src build/XMP_BuildInfo.h -> src third-party/MD5/* -> src License ======= Copyright (c) 2007 Andreas Huggel <ahuggel@gmx.net> Copyright (c) 1999 - 2007, Adobe Systems Incorporated Copyright (c) 1991-2, RSA Data Security, Inc.
